点云
计算机科学
点(几何)
管道(软件)
修剪
人工智能
计算机视觉
启发式
算法
数学
几何学
农学
生物
程序设计语言
作者
Xuefeng Tan,Dejun Zhang,Tian Li,Yonghong Wu,Yilin Chen
标识
DOI:10.1016/j.cag.2022.07.002
摘要
Point clouds captured by 3D scans are typically sparse, irregular, and noisy, resulting in 3D wireframes reconstructed by existing approaches often containing redundant edges or lacking proper edges. To tackle these issues, this paper proposes a coarse-to-fine pipeline for 3D wireframe reconstruction from point clouds. First, a learning-based module is dedicated to predicting the corner and edge points from the input point cloud, and each pair of corner points is linked together to generate an initial 3D wireframe. Second, a coarse pruning module is utilized to generate a coarse 3D wireframe, which is achieved by pruning observable redundant edges from the initial 3D wireframe based on the asymmetric Chamfer distance. Third, a refined pruning module is used to generate a refined 3D wireframe with correct topological structures, which can help prune redundant edges that are difficult to observe from the coarse 3D wireframe. Finally, a heuristic algorithm is exploited to fine-tune the refined 3D wireframe to ensure the final 3D wireframe preserves the characteristics of both vertical and parallel. The experimental results reveal that the proposed method significantly improves the performance of 3D wireframes reconstruction from point clouds on the large-scale ABC dataset and a challenging furniture dataset.
科研通智能强力驱动
Strongly Powered by AbleSci AI